NCAA basketball tournament reportedly expanding to 76 teams: What to know

The NCAA basketball tournament is reportedly expanding to 76 teams, with the addition of eight games to the current 'First Four' format. The expansion is expected to be finalized soon, with the added games providing more TV revenue and changing the dynamics of the tournament, including what constitutes a 'bubble team'.
The NCAA basketball tournament is expanding to 76 teams. The expansion adds eight games to the 'First Four' format, played over two days at two sites. The 12 winners advance to the original bracket, joining 52 teams. This change rewards more teams and alters the 'bubble team' concept. The expansion is expected to be finalized soon, with added TV revenue being a key factor.
